Pfizer expands its Singapore Nutrition Plant

In July, Pfizer announced a US$100 million (S$131.4 million) investment in the expansion of its Singapore Nutrition Plant to strengthen its position as the manufacturer of high-quality, safe and environment-friendly nutritional products in Asia. The expansion, which brings the total investment to US$372 million (S$488.6 million), makes it one of the world's largest nutritional plants.


The new 91,963-square-metre plant will boost the production capacity by 50 per cent and increase its ability to supply nutrition products to Singapore and key markets such as China, Indonesia, Malaysia, Pakistan, Sri Lanka, Thailand, Taiwan, Hong Kong and Vietnam. The Pfizer Singapore Nutritional Plant achieves sustainability through the use of advanced technology aimed at maximising energy efficiency and reducing waste. Over 50 percent of water used by the plant for maintenance purposes is recycled.


"With about 120 colleagues working in Quality Operations alone, the plant maintains the highest quality and safety standards throughout every stage of the production process," said Natale Ricciardi, Senior Vice President of Pfizer and President of Pfizer Global Manufacturing.
